Public bug reported:

The route table intermittently loses all routing information, resulting
in "Network unreachable" errors. Normally things work fine, and my ASDL
modem connected via ethernet is problem free. Running the "route"
command gives this:

Kernel IP routing table
Destination     Gateway         Genmask         Flags Metric Ref    Use Iface
10.0.0.0        *               255.0.0.0       U     0      0        0 eth0
default         10.1.1.1        0.0.0.0         UG    0      0        0 eth0

But often (say 70% of the time) about 30 seconds after starting Azureus
the route table is empty. All network communications fail, including
pinging my modem. Azureus is not running as root. It should not be able
to clear the route table.

The problem typically remains for one to five minutes, and then
everything starts working by itself. The route table gets its entries
back. On some occasions the problems appear to persist for hours (e.g.
often during overnight downloads). Stopping Azureus always seems to fix
the problem within a minute or so.

Azureus seems to be the only app I can find that triggers this issue.
But clearly it is not a bug in Azureus, since it should not be able to
affect the route table.

The version given by uname -a is:
Linux ubuntu 2.6.15-25-k7 #1 SMP PREEMPT Wed Jun 14 11:43:20 UTC 2006 i686 
GNU/Linux
